I will be upgrading my sound system for the sole fact that Honda cannot, and I repeat, cannot make a decent sound system in their $40k cars. Their "premium" 360W sound system in the Accord Touring is an absolute joke. Did a lot of research and really comes down to crappy speakers, and an amp that makes the signal flat as hell. Head unit produces a good clear signal so thankfully I won't need to upgrade that but those speakers and probably the sub are going to be replaced along with a new amp.

Never buy Honda for sound. Worse part is I'm told their Acura sound is actually pretty decent...just god Honda what's wrong with you...

Cant really tell but its actually molded to the contours of the rear hatch and the back of the seat. It takes out the factory jack as its about the size of a basketball for airspace. Minimum of 6 layers (1/4" thick) fiberglass resin. All seams have been filled with fiberglass putty.

Learned alot from the first box. Didnt leave enough clearance around the subwoofer surround. Other mistake was mdf really only likes to be installed once. This time around, the sub is secured via bolts and threadserts.
